WebDec 7, 2024 · Contemporary pacemakers are versatile and capable of the most commonly used pacing modes and basic functions (ie, mode switching and rate responsiveness). … WebJul 20, 2024 · Pacing Basics (Table 18.1) Temporary pacing provides an electrical stimulus to the heart to produce mechanical contraction. Pacing, whether temporary or permanent, uses NBG nomenclature (NASPE and BPEG together) to specify the mode of pacing. WebMar 19, 2024 · The pacing is usually set to demand (as required) at 70-80 beats per minute starting low (eg. 30 mA) and increasing until electrical capture with established output occurs. In some settings (such as pre-hospital) where there is a concern that electrical artifact may inhibit pacing in the demand mode, it is reasonable to use a fixed ...
